Whether you're expanding a maritime collection, enhancing your office, or investing in a museum-quality display piece, our handcrafted F\/V Cornelia Marie model is built to become an impressive centerpiece you'll be proud to display for generations.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eContact us today to begin building your custom F\/V Cornelia Marie model.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eHistory\u003cbr\u003e\nThe F\/V Cornelia Marie is one of the most iconic commercial fishing vessels in Alaska, with a legacy closely tied to the history of the modern Bering Sea crab fishery. Built in 1989 by Horton Boats in Bayou La Batre, Alabama, the rugged 128-foot house-aft vessel was purpose-built to withstand some of the harshest operating conditions in the world. Powered by twin 750-horsepower Cummins diesel engines, the F\/V Cornelia Marie was designed for year-round service across multiple Alaskan fisheries and features a spacious working deck capable of carrying up to 180 steel crab pots during demanding crab fishing seasons.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eThe vessel gained worldwide recognition under the command of the legendary Captain Phil Harris, becoming one of the best-known boats featured on the television series Deadliest Catch. To extend its commercial service life, the F\/V Cornelia Marie underwent extensive refurbishment and modernization in 2015, including structural upgrades, new propulsion equipment, advanced navigation systems, and its distinctive blue-and-white exterior. Today, the vessel remains a celebrated symbol of the skill, resilience, and determination that define Alaska’s commercial fishing industry.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Captain Heritage","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":48354501787869,"sku":"CM947","price":0.0,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"url":"https:\/\/captainheritage.com\/tr\/products\/cm947-f-v-time-bandit-36-inches-fishing-boat-model","provider":"Captain Heritage","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
